The Weather Channel - Radar app is free to download and use, which is a significant advantage for anyone looking to stay informed about weather conditions without breaking the bank. There are some features available through in-app purchases, but the free version is robust enough for casual users. For those who want an ad-free experience or additional features, the premium subscription is reasonably priced, making it an attractive option for avid weather followers.

When it comes to security and privacy, The Weather Channel - Radar app prioritizes user safety and data protection. Available on both the App Store and Google Play, it adheres to industry standards for app security. During registration, the app requires minimal personal information, primarily your location to provide localized weather updates. This is a plus in terms of privacy, as it doesn't ask for unnecessary data. However, it's worth noting that the app does display ads, which can sometimes raise concerns about tracking behavior. While ads are common in free apps, it's essential to review the privacy policy to understand how your data might be used. Overall, I feel secure using the app, but I recommend that users stay informed about privacy settings to maintain control over their information.
